Carnilove into the wild Salmon & Turkey is a grain-free and potato-free formula for kittens. This kibble contains everything kittens need. By using high-quality proteins and a high meat content, Carnilove kitten provides a naturally healthy diet for young cats without unnecessary ingredients or additives. Carnilove kitten contains turkey and salmon meat.
Ingredients : salmon meal (25%), turkey meal (24%), yellow peas (18%), chicken fat (preserved with tocopherols, 11%), hydrolyzed chicken protein (9%), chicken liver (3%), salmon oil (3%), tapioca starch (2%), apples (1%), carrots (1%), linseed (1%), chickpeas (1%), hydrolyzed crustacean shells (a source of glucosamine, 0.028%), cartilage extract (a source of chondroitin, 0.017%), brewer's yeast (a source of mannan-oligosaccharides, 0.017%), chicory root (a source of fructo-oligosaccharides, 0.014%), yucca schidigera (0.01%), algae (0.01%), psyllium (0.01%), thyme (0.01%), rosemary (0.01%), oregano (0.01%), cranberries (0.0008%), blueberries (0.0008%), raspberries (0.0008%).
Analysis : Crude protein 40%, fat 20%, crude fibre 2%, crude ash 7.5%, moisture 10%, calcium 1.3%, phosphorus 1%, sodium 0.5%, magnesium 0.08%
Nutritional advice:
| Age of the cat | Amount in grams/day |
| 1 - 4 months | 25 - 45 g |
| 4 - 7 months | 45 - 60 g |
| 7 - 12 months | 60 - 100 g |
